Entrepreneurial Leadership Center
The Entrepreneurial Leadership Center (ELC) empowers East Stroudsburg University students to transform ideas into business ventures. Through events, workshops, mentorship, and student competitions, ESU’s emerging entrepreneurs learn, test, and refine their entrepreneurial skills.
Warrior Launchpad – ESU’s Student Business Incubator
Our premier membership-based student incubator helps students launch and grow their companies. Members engage in cross-collaborative experiences with regional and international business leaders, gaining real-world insights to guide their entrepreneurial journey.
Opportunities to Get Involved
Entrepreneurship Club: Join a community of like-minded students passionate about innovation and business.
Student Competitions: Compete for cash and in-kind prizes in the Warrior Startup Challenge and the tecBRIDGE Business Plan Competition.
